7-氯-5-(2-氯苯基)-1,3-二氢-3H-1,4-苯并二氮杂卓-2-酮 制备方法及用途

制备方法

用于劳拉西泮、三唑仑、氯马唑仑等原料药合成

7-氯-5-(2-氯苯基)-1,3-二氢-3H-1,4-苯并二氮杂卓-2-酮 物化性质

外观与性状:
灰白色至淡黄色固体
密度:
1.42 g/cm3
熔点:
187-189ºC
沸点:
481.7ºC at 760 mmHg
闪点:
245.1ºC
折射率:
1.673
蒸汽压:
1.94E-09mmHg at 25°C
